The Authorization Specialist is responsible for supporting the prior authorization request to ensure all authorization requests are addressed properly and in the contractual timeline. Aids utilization management team to document authorization requests and obtain accurate and timely documentation for services related to the members healthcare eligibility and access.
Job Responsibilities:
Receive faxes, triage them, and send out to the appropriate teams within Superior HealthPlan
Supporting intake department to streamline the intake process
Candidate needs to be comfortable typing fast and inputting data through the day
Enters pertinent claims information from source documents
Corrects entries where indicated.
Maintains appropriate records, files, documentation, etc.
Processing for teams including Concurrent Review, Behavioral Health, and Medicare, etc. – department is open 7 days/week because of this level of exposure to the business.
Supports authorization requests for services in accordance with the insurance prior authorization list
Supports and performs data entry to maintain and update authorization requests into utilization management system
Assists utilization management team with ongoing tracking and appropriate documentation on authorizations and referrals in accordance with policies and guidelines
Contributes to the authorization review process by documenting necessary medical information such as history, diagnosis, and prognosis based on the referral to the clinical reviewer for determination
Remains up-to-date on healthcare, authorization processes, policies and procedures
Performs other duties as assigned
Complies with all policies and standards
Team will process anywhere from 3,500 to 4,000 faxes per day – need to get the faxes out to other teams within 1-2 hours of receiving, depending on the form
10,000 keystrokes an hour – 50 to 60 WPM, very fast-paced team
Job Requirements:
High school diploma or equivalent – Required
Understanding of medical terminology and insurance preferred.
Entry-level position typically requiring little or no previous experience.
